Technician, Other

A collective term for persons with specialized training in various narrow fields of expertise whose occupations require training and skills in specific technical processes and procedures; and where further classification is deemed unnecessary by the user.

PROSKIN LLC is a technician located in BLOOMINGTON, MN. NPPES has assigned the NPI number 1851969927 to PROSKIN LLC on June 15, 2021. It is a Type-2 NPI, indicating this NPI number is associated with an organization. The primary taxonomy selected by this provider is 247200000X from the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set, which is classified as Technician, Other.

Note: NPPES allows providers to attest to the accuracy of their NPI data. When a provider request any change to the NPI record, they will be able to attest to their changed NPI data, resulting in an updated certification date.
